In the present day, we’ve reached a stage the place organizations are counting on programming languages like by no means earlier than. With programming in place, organizations have met their enterprise objectives in the absolute best method. If you’re a freelancer in programming then it is very important have a good understanding as to that are essentially the most in demand programming languages out there and are straightforward to be taught too. On this article, we’ll speak about prime 10 customized software program improvement programming languages in 2023.
Python
Python is a broadly accepted server-side programming language due to its wide selection of purposes. Be it easy scripting or superior net purposes, you don’t have anything to fret about for Python has acquired you coated. Because of python, the builders can now use varied programming types together with reflecting, purposeful, and many others. No marvel why python is taken into account to be one of many best and marketable programming languages to be taught.
JavaScript
If, as a freelancer, your purpose is to create dynamic net components resembling animated graphics, interactive maps, and many others., then nothing could be a higher option to depend on than JavaScript. This programming language is extensively utilized in net improvement, constructing net servers, sport improvement, and many others.
Golang (Go)
Go, a programming language developed by Google has garnered consideration from in every single place throughout the globe within the least doable time. Its very capability to deal with multicore and networked techniques and large codebases has gained it consideration. Thus, Golang making it to the checklist of prime 10 programming languages that freelancers favor to be taught, doesn’t appear to shock anybody.
Java
Freelancers aiming to make a profession in net improvement, software improvement and large knowledge can blindly depend on Java. Java is a general-purpose programming language with an object-oriented construction that’s owned by Oracle Company.
C#
C# has grabbed eyeballs from each nook of the world due to its capability to assist the ideas of object-oriented programming. This is likely one of the prime causes behind its growing recognition. As C# works on Home windows, Android, and iOS, freelancers gained’t face any drawback in studying this language.
R
So far as processing statistics, together with linear and nonlinear modelling, calculation, testing, visualization, and evaluation are involved, there can’t be a greater programming language to supply the specified outcomes than R. Proper from its existence, R has continued to open doorways of alternatives.
C++
What can get higher than a programming language boasting of options resembling knowledge abstraction, polymorphism, inheritance, and many others.,? Nicely, that is precisely what C++ has in retailer for you. Undoubtedly, you might be sure to get good earnings in addition to alternatives in your programming profession. Some extent price a point out is that this programming language is broadly utilized in desktop software improvement, GUI software improvement, 3D sport improvement, and constructing real-time mathematical options.
Swift
Nicely, as a matter of truth, Swift is a comparatively new language however is very most popular by freelancers in addition to different programmers and builders due to its velocity, efficiency, and safety. Moreover, Swift is a straightforward language to be taught thereby making it so much simpler for freelancers.
Kotlin
Off late, Kotlin, an open-source programming language has gained enormous recognition a lot in order that firms resembling Netflix, Pinterest, and Amazon Internet Companies make use of this language. This may be accounted for primarily due to its options resembling assist for lambda capabilities, good casts, null security, and operator overloading.
Ruby
Yet one more programming language that’s extremely most popular by freelancers and net builders is Ruby. It’s because Ruby has a syntax that’s straightforward to learn and write. Yet one more level that’s price a point out is that its object-oriented structure helps procedural and purposeful programming notation.